Ok everyone. I had a great plan to make this move 100% transparent to everyone however my current hosting provider blocks ALL mysql connections so "I'm boned"

Here is what to expect: A disabled message board until the DNS servers you look at are updated.

1: The old server message board will be locked so no more changes happen to the database.
2: I copy the database and all files to the new host
3: I update the DNS servers to point at the new host.
4: I re-enable the new host message board.
5: When your DNS servers have the changes, the board "magicly" works again.
6: I fly down to florida with a clue-by-four and visit the old hosting provider ;)

the big "?" is #5. Depending on the world, this step can take anywhere from 48 seconds to 48 hours. I may get motivated and do the move later today.
